F and V Operations & Resource Management (FVOP), newly contracted to manage Mount Clemens utilities, reported two weeks of assessments identifying solids‑handling pressure at the wastewater plant, staff interviews, inventory work, and plans for monthly safety training and system inventories to support equipment and maintenance planning.

Mount Clemens on July 20 heard an initial report from F and V Operations & Resource Management (FVOP), the firm the city recently contracted to manage its utilities operations, that identified a critical solids‑handling pressure point at the wastewater plant and outlined immediate steps for staff training and asset inventories.
